Neryn continues her training as the Gathering approaches. She must ensure that she is ready by midsummer for the conflict. Flint is having greater difficulties keeping up appearances at court, the needs of the cause are pushing his heart to the breaking point. Everyone is tested even further when a second male caller is found and begins working with the king. The conflict truly comes to a head in this novel.

While the series could end here, I wish it would continue like the Sevenwaters trilogy. I would like to see how the story progresses through generations. I love this world and the characters in it!

Beautiful. I loved every page of it. Neryn grew on me and has become one of my favourite book characters. I love that she wasn't silly, whiny or superficial.

She stuck to her job and did it well. Not once did she do anything dumb and her respect for everyone made me like her even more.

This third book was amazing not only because of the character developments, but because it made us see the villains as humans too.

The enforcers whom we used to hate in the first two books became our friends.

The ending disappointed me a little though. I wanted to know what happens to all the other characters as well. It was too abrupt for me (maybe because I just wanted more).

All in all, this is definitely a book I will pick up to read again.
